The Big Game Of The Day

Today's big game has to be Kentucky-Louisville. This is one of the
stranger years for this rivalry, though. Louisville has won the last two
years. Kentucky is struggling at 4-4 and a loss to Louisville would send
some Kentucky fans around the bend.
Louisville is almost certainly licking
their chops over casting such a pall over Lexington, but they are 5-2 and their
losses have been to VCU and Xavier. Not humiliating, but not scintillating.
Their wins have been non-descript, but they did defeat Georgia at Georgia.

On the other hand, Louisville is scoring 35% of their points off of
turnovers, which is very impressive, and Kentucky
has a hard time hanging on to the ball
.
